- The distance between Fort Worth, Tx, Usa and Songea, Tanzania is approximately 14,594 km or 9,069 mi.
- To reach Fort Worth, Tx in this distance one would set out from Songea bearing 304.7°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Fort Worth, Tx bearing 254.1° or WSW .
- Fort Worth, Tx has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Songea has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- Both are in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 2.4 °C (4.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.3 °C (31.1°F) more in Fort Worth, Tx.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 293.9 mm (11.6 in) less which is equivalent to 293.9 l/m² (7.21 US gal/ft²) or 2,939,000 l/ha (314,199 US gal/ac) less. About 3/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.6° lower in Fort Worth, Tx than in Songea.
